A former Rockstar Games employee indicates that the decision will only be made closer to the game's release.
The end of 2023 was marked by the presentation of the first trailer for 'GTA VI', with Rockstar Games announcing a few months later that its highly anticipated new game in the saga would be released in the fall of 2025. However, it is still possible that the game will be delayed.
This is what Obbe Vermeij, a former Rockstar North employee who worked on several titles in the series such as 'GTA III', 'GTA: Vice City' and also 'GTA: San Andreas', says.
Vermeij recalled on the social network X (formerly Twitter) that “the decision to postpone ‘GTA IV’ was made four months before the original release date” and that Rockstar Games “probably won't be in a position to determine whether it will be able to release [‘GTA VI’] until May”. Even so, the former producer doesn't think that Rockstar Games is in any hurry to release the title.
“'GTA VI' will be sold for more than ten years and there's no competition to worry about,” wrote Vermeij. “They will release the game when they are 100% satisfied with it. Regardless of what appeared in the trailer.”
It's worth remembering that 'GTA V', the latest game in the series, was released in September 2013 and remains to this day one of the most popular games among video game aficionados - a fact largely due to the game's online mode.
